Every August for the past 33 years, the annual ‘Celebration of Canadian Motocross ‘ transforms the hamlet of Walton into “Motocross Town”. Join the crowd where champions are crowned and celebrate Canada’s best amateur racers annually at the Walton TransCan Amateur Grand National Championship on August 6-10. The Goderich Celtic Roots Festival returns to the shores of Lake Huron in beautiful Lions’ Harbour Park from August 8–10, 2025, offering a joyous celebration of the music, craft, dance, and culture of the seven Celtic nations. Featuring over 60 hours of live performances across five stages—from intimate acoustic showcases to high-energy headliners like the MacMaster Leahy Family—this three-day outdoor event also includes fresh local food, artisan markets, kids’ activities, workshops (Celtic College and Kids Camp), and cultural demos. Festival and day‑pass tickets are available (youth and seniors discounts, free for 12‑and‑under), so bring the whole family and immerse yourself in a rich Celtic tradition.

Bayfield Fair returns the third weekend in August—August 15–17, 2025—bringing 169 years of small‑town charm and celebration to the Bayfield Agricultural Park at 1 Fry Street. This family‑friendly festival blends agricultural heritage with fun: think 4‑H and horse shows, animal displays and homecraft exhibitions, inflatables and interactive demos, live music, a lively parade, food vendors, a BBQ dinner on Friday, and a fireworks show Saturday night with free kids’ admission and affordable passes, it’s the perfect weekend escape to enjoy community spirit, local talent, and classic fair fun by Lake Huron.
